Secret Features of Comfortable Sofas
Support and Structure: An excellent sofa ought to have a well-constructed frame made from wood or top quality engineered wood. The support system, whether it's springs or foam cushions, must keep you comfortable without drooping over time.
Cushioning: The type of cushioning utilized plays a considerable function in defining comfort. Sofas typically use foam, down, or a combination of both. High-density foam offers firmness and sturdiness, while down provides a plush feel.
Upholstery: The choice of material is equally important. Sofas can be upholstered in various materials, varying from leather to polyester and cotton blends. Each product has its benefits and drawbacks concerning feel, resilience, and upkeep.
Design and style: The aesthetic appeals of the sofa should balance with the overall decoration of your home. Consider the size, shape, and color to ensure it complements your area.
Reduce of Maintenance: Choose a sofa with removable and washable covers or one made from stain-resistant materials, particularly if you have family pets or children.
Kinds Of Comfortable Sofas
Various types of sofas deal with differing comfort requirements and style preferences. The following table lays out some popular options:
| Sofa Type | Description | Comfort Level | Perfect For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sectional Sofa | A multi-piece sofa that can be configured in different plans. | High | Bigger households and social areas |
| Recliner chair Sofa | A sofa that permits you to recline the backrest and frequently has integrated footrests. | Very High | Film nights and relaxation |
| Sofa bed | A sofa that converts into a bed for over night guests. | Moderate | Visitor rooms and little spaces |
| Loveseat | A smaller sofa developed for two individuals. | Moderate | Relaxing spaces and couples |
| Seat | An extended sofa with an extended seat for lounging. | High | Checking out and relaxing |

Upkeep Tips for Sofas
To lengthen the life of your comfortable sofa, follow these maintenance ideas:
- Regular Cleaning: Vacuum the sofa weekly to get rid of dust and particles. Use a soft brush accessory to avoid damaging the upholstery.
- Area Clean: For discolorations, use a cleaner specifically designed for your sofa product. Always test on an inconspicuous location first.
- Avoid Direct Sunlight: Placing your sofa near windows can cause fading. Usage drapes or blinds to safeguard the upholstery.
- Rotate Cushions: If your sofa has removable cushions, turn them routinely to make sure even wear.
- Expert Cleaning: Schedule an expert cleaning a minimum of as soon as a year to maintain the fabric and structure.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What is the most comfortable material for a sofa?
The most comfy product differs by preference. Leather is durable and easy to clean, while fabric can be comfortable and warm. Microfiber is also popular for its softness and stain resistance.
2. How long should a comfortable sofa last?
A quality sofa can last anywhere from 7 to 15 years, depending upon the products used, care, and amount of use.
3. Can I tailor my sofa?
Many producers provide customization choices, including fabric options, colors, and cushion firmness, permitting you to develop a sofa that meets your needs.
4. How do I know if a sofa is too firm or too soft?
A well-balanced sofa must supply assistance while also feeling comfortable. If you sink in too deeply, it may lack assistance, while an extremely firm sofa might not be comfy for prolonged sitting.
5. Is it worth investing in a high-quality sofa?
Yes, investing in a top quality sofa frequently indicates much better products and workmanship, resulting in higher convenience and durability.
